原文:Oracle 清空一个表的数据(数据量大的做法)

如果有一张表有上千万条数据,需要清空这个表的数据,你会怎么解决 如果用delete,会卡上半天时间,不可行。需要用truncatetable去解决,如下: 先创建一个备份表 createtable 备份表 as select from 千万条数据的表 清空数据 truncatetable 千万条数据的表 如果需要保留部分数据 insertinto 千万条数据的表select from备份表wher ...

2020-04-30 09:52 0 637 推荐指数:

查看详情

oracle如何查询哪个数据量大

是存储空间大还是记录条数大?存储空间可以用如下语句查:select * from user_segments s where s.BYTES is ...

Mon Jan 08 05:37:00 CST 2018 0 6896
oracle如何查询哪个数据量大

存储空间可以用如下语句查:select * from user_segments s where s.BYTES is not null order by s.BYTES desc 查记录条数 ...

Thu Dec 21 00:33:00 CST 2017 0 2635
hive 查询数据量大

为什么要查询数据量 在做数据仓库管理时,数据导入hive或向生成数据形成的数据资产,表里的数据量和占用存储空间是重要的元数据属性。为方便数据使用时计算资源的分配,对数据要有基本的了解,所以需要对表的数据量做统计。 使用 analyze table 主动生成元数据信息 分区 ...

Fri Jun 05 20:02:00 CST 2020 4 15020
oracle 数据量大时如何快速查找需要数据

查询eai_salesorder中是否有今天(20180712)的数据。 方法一 select * from eai_salesorder where eaicreatedate like '2018-07-12%'; 用时 20.176秒 方法二 select * from ...

Thu Jul 12 18:30:00 CST 2018 0 1237
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M